Rip, Ride, Rockit at night is amazing. Hulk is also right up there as the last thing you see coming out of the gamma tube is a lit up Hogwarts castle.
 
Hippogriff. The view of Hogwarts at night is spectacular.

Jurrasic Park works well, too (altho not as good as Jaws was).
 
Jaws (RIP)

Rockit (all the lights are fun), Ripsaw Falls, Hulk, Doctor Doom (great aerial view of the park all lit up), Storm Force (the strobe effect is cool), Jurassic Park (scarier).
 
In addition to the previous answers, I would also add Doctor Doom's Tower Of Fear. Request a park view seat.

Opps. DM has it mentioned in his post.
 
Jurassic Park now that Jaws is gone. The end is great because you really don't know when you're going to drop. Typically, during the daytime u can see in frotnt of you where you're path goes...not at night....MUHAHAHAHA! :cool2:
 
Hippogriff. As you are chugging up the incline you get a great slow view of Hogwarts at night up close. At the peak of the first hill you get the best park view.
